In Culture warrior he examines the goals and method’s of the secular-progressive movement (S-P) and it’s plans to convert the U.S. into a European style secular society. He makes an interesting case that it is not about liberal vs. conservative nor Democrat vs. Republican, but it is about traditionalist vs. secular-progressive. As you read this book you will come to understand the differences between the S-P agenda and the values of most Americans. You will look at issues between parents and public schools, wealth vs. social programs, national foreign policy vs. global foreign policy and a host of other issues.

Are you a traditionalist? Take this short quiz and see where you stand.

He points to those (in his opinion) who are the leaders of the S-P movement today. They include George Lakoff, George Soros, Peter Lewis, Howard Dean and others. If you have read any of Mr. O’Reilly’s previous books, listened to his radio show or watched his television show you know he is not shy to name names and can usually back up his assertions with logical debate. He takes on the main stream media and Hollywood with equal vigor. But I do want to leave this with Mr. O’Reilly’s code of the traditional warrior. See if this fits you.

Code Of The Traditional Warrior
Keep your promises
Focus on other people, not yourself
See the world the way it is, not the way you want it to be
Understand and respect Judeo-Christian philosophy
Respect the nobility of America
Allow yourself to make fact based judgments
Respect and defend private property
Develop mental toughness
Defend the weak and vulnerable
Engage the secular-progressive opposition in a straight forward and Honest manner
